What does lagoon mean?
noun
A body of water, usually a shallow one, that is separated from a larger body of water by a barrier of land or sand, or a small body of water, often a part of a larger body of water, such as a sea or ocean.
Example
"The lagoon was a popular spot for swimming and snorkeling, with its crystal-clear waters and vibrant marine life."
